Culver City Wants to Hear From You …. About Finances
The City Council is now soliciting the Community's input on the State of the City's Finances. On Monday, June 18, 2012, the City Council held the first of five planned Dialogue meetings to discuss the state of the City's finances and receive public input on this very important topic. AVPA Theater to Get New Director – Jill Novick
After teaching Drama and English during her first year at Culver City High School, Jill Novick has accepted the position of Creative Director of Theatre for AVPA for the 2012-13 school year. Current Creative Director Justin Lujan will be stepping down from the position, but will still be involved in teaching and directing with AVPA Theatre during the next year.
